Medlock Square marks a bold new chapter in the evolution of the Etihad Campus — a vibrant, year‑round destination for culture, leisure and entertainment, set alongside two global icons: the Etihad Stadium, home of Manchester City Football Club, and the landmark Co‑op Live arena.

Named after the River Medlock that runs beneath the site, the development celebrates Manchester’s industrial heritage while shaping its next era of city‑defining experiences. Manchester is known worldwide for its sport, music and entertainment — and Medlock Square will build on that legacy, creating a landmark home for exceptional shared moments and elevating the city’s position as one of Europe’s most dynamic, fast‑growing destinations.

At the heart of this new district will be an extraordinary food and beverage offer: from relaxed coffee houses and all‑day dining to flagship restaurants and premium culinary experiences. Designed to serve both everyday visitors and major event audiences, Medlock Square will deliver high‑quality hospitality all week long and across the events calendar.

About the role

As Café \& Bar Manager \- Blend, you will lead the operation of a relaxed yet high\-quality café and bar concept designed to transition effortlessly from day to night. Blend is a welcoming, versatile space \- serving specialty coffee and artisanal pastries by day, before evolving into a laid\-back evening destination offering curated wines, craft beers, and simple, well\-executed drinks.

You will be accountable for the full guest journey, team performance, and commercial success of the venue \-ensuring the offer remains relevant, consistent, and appealing throughout the day\-to\-night transition.

As a visible, hands\-on leader, you’ll set the tone of the space \- balancing energy, service style, and atmosphere to suit each moment, from relaxed daytime trade to a more social evening environment.

Working closely with senior hospitality leaders and wider campus teams, you will position Blend as a go\-to destination within the Etihad Campus for both everyday visits and event\-driven footfall. You will be responsible for:

Service \& Guest Experience
Deliver a friendly, approachable, and high\-quality guest experience aligned to a relaxed café and bar environment. Create a seamless transition in atmosphere and service style between daytime café trading and evening bar operations while ensuring guests receive consistent and engaging service throughout the day. Manage guest flow, queues, and busy trading periods effectively, responding to guest feedback professionally and using insights to continuously enhance the overall experience. Ensure the venue remains clean, welcoming, and fully operational at all times.

Team Leadership \& Development
Lead, recruit, train, and develop a versatile front\-of\-house team capable of delivering both café and bar service to a high standard. Foster a positive, inclusive, and energetic team culture while setting clear expectations around service, product knowledge, presentation, and guest interaction. Deliver regular team briefings, coaching, and performance feedback while supporting the development of multi\-skilled team members across all areas of the operation. Manage rotas and staffing levels in line with trading patterns, business needs, and event activity.

Operational Management
Oversee the day\-to\-day operation of the café and bar, ensuring smooth and efficient service across all trading periods. Manage transitions between daytime café and evening bar setups, including staffing, atmosphere, stock, and product availability. Maintain strong operational standards across ordering, stock control, cleanliness, and service delivery while adapting operations to support matchdays, concerts, and event\-driven demand. Work closely with kitchen, front\-of\-house, and support teams to ensure effective communication and operational consistency.

Commercial Performance \& Cost Control
Support the commercial success of the venue through strong product knowledge, upselling, and creating repeat guest visits. Monitor key performance indicators including sales, covers, spend per head, labour efficiency, and guest satisfaction while identifying opportunities to improve performance. Manage stock effectively, minimise wastage, and support ordering and cost control processes. Contribute to budgeting, forecasting, and local initiatives designed to drive revenue and enhance the guest offer.

Compliance, Safety \& Standards
Ensure compliance with all food safety, health \& safety, hygiene, and licensing standards across the operation. Maintain accurate records, daily checks, and operational procedures while promoting safe working practices for both guests and team members. Ensure high standards of cleanliness, presentation, and operational readiness are consistently maintained throughout the venue.

Collaboration \& Continuous Improvement
Work closely with chefs, operational leaders, and wider campus teams to deliver a consistent and engaging food and beverage offer. Support seasonal menu launches, promotions, activations, and new initiatives while identifying opportunities to improve service flow, operational efficiency, product quality, and the overall guest experience.### Skills, Knowledge \& Expertise
